Transaction 623dedc256c517402df523d8523436fd0586a462327df9cf573a9c1b52acbf82
1 Input
1 Output
-
623dedc256c517402df523d8523436fd0586a462327df9cf573a9c1b52acbf82:0
- value
- 178433
- script pubkey
- OP_0 OP_PUSHBYTES_20 c85dbe484b2ad1000de76dac6d68ebb8ed9c9c72
- address
- bc1qepwmujzt9tgsqr08dkkx668thrkee8rjujrh2f